Preservationist, naturalist, author, explorer, activist, scientist, farmer, John Muir (4/21/1838 - 12/24/1914) was all these things and more. Explaining his impact then and now, this 90-minute documentary delves into Muir's life with reenactments filmed in the majestic landscapes he visited: Wisconsin, Yosemite and the Sierra Nevada, the Alhambra Valley of California, and the glaciers of Alaska.
